If you've been searching for indoor travel spots to visit with kids in Jeju, you've probably come across Teddy Bear Museum Jeju, located near Jungmun Resort in Seogwipo. Built around the familiar, comforting theme of teddy bears, it's often introduced as a space that's just as welcoming to adults as it is to children. True to its name, this exhibition hall is said to be themed around a wide variety of teddy bears, and it doesn't stop at simply displaying dolls — it's said to include exhibition zones that recreate scenes from history and culture using teddy bears themselves. Several other indoor travel spots are also said to cluster around Jungmun Resort, so quite a few visitors are said to group Teddy Bear Museum with those nearby spots when mapping out a rainy-day itinerary. An Indoor Hall Filled With Teddy Bears of Every Kind

Stepping into Teddy Bear Museum Jeju, you're said to find teddy bears of every size, expression, and outfit filling the space. From small, delicately dressed dolls to bears as tall as a person, a wide range of sizes are said to be on display, and being able to take in such varied shapes and scales all in one place is said to be one of the charms visitors mention most often. From palm-sized miniature bears to giant ones that tower well over a visitor's head, the range of scale is said to be considerable, and visitors are said to enjoy the fun of taking it all in as they move between these two extremes. Discovering just how much variety a single material — the teddy bear — can produce is said to be a recurring surprise among visitors.

What especially draws attention is that the museum is said to include exhibition zones recreating historical scenes or cultures from around the world using teddy bears. Bears are said to be dressed in period costumes or arranged into specific scenes, giving the impression of watching a small puppet-theater stage — though exactly which era or culture each zone depicts is said to vary depending on how the exhibition is arranged at the time, so I'd rather not pin that down definitively here. Moving from one zone to the next is said to feel like turning the pages of a short storybook, leaving visitors with the impression that the humble teddy bear can be woven into far more varied storytelling than they expected. What does come up consistently across visitor reviews, though, is that this is a space aiming to hold stories and settings, not just a simple bear display.

The Care and Detail Behind Every Single Bear

Walking through the museum, it's said that the level of care put into each individual bear stands out. Visitors often mention noticing small details like seam lines, embroidery, and accessories that seem to have been carefully thought through, and the impression from up close is said to feel quite different from the impression at a distance. The texture and color of the fur is said to vary slightly from bear to bear, and picking up on these subtle differences is said to be one of the small pleasures of a visit. Thanks to this kind of fine detail, the atmosphere is said to come through clearly even in photos.

That may be part of why Teddy Bear Museum is also often mentioned as a good spot for families, couples, or friends to take photos together. Visitors are said to enjoy posing alongside the bears or walking among them against the backdrop of each differently themed space, and since it's an indoor venue, the lighting and staging are also said to have been designed with photography in mind — which is likely why it comes up so often among those looking for photogenic travel spots. A dedicated photo zone is also said to be set up somewhere in the museum, so if you're hoping to take home plenty of keepsake photos, it's worth keeping an eye out for it.

Near Jungmun Resort, an Indoor Spot Unbothered by Weather

The Jungmun Resort area, where Teddy Bear Museum is located, is well known as a district where a variety of Jeju travel spots cluster together, and among them, this museum seems to stand out as an especially welcome option for being an indoor space where you can spend time at ease, regardless of the weather. Several other art museums and hands-on exhibition spaces are also said to be located nearby, so many travelers are said to combine them into a single day-long course around the Jungmun Resort area. On rainy or particularly windy days, when outdoor plans need adjusting, having a place like this nearby is said to make planning a trip noticeably easier — something I hear often.

Using the familiar material of teddy bears to bring together children and adults alike, and layering in stories of history and culture on top of that, is what seems to make Teddy Bear Museum more than just a photo zone.
